Output 24c531396e4d9fa896be93a6d94775487a67cc83fc79b28310a25b1d5daa47a6:2

value
25787960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ee1857e0a3d94e00bfd7df92dc5aee6b78f10dda OP_EQUAL
address
MVc6DV96kZrjgfXF1JGGpvFserMSjMqH75
transaction
24c531396e4d9fa896be93a6d94775487a67cc83fc79b28310a25b1d5daa47a6
spent
true